Your checkbook shows a balance of $413. Your bank statement says you have $373. Assuming you are missing just one transaction, what is the amount of the transaction you are missing?

If your account shows a balance of $413 and you only have one missing transaction, with a final balance in your account of $373, then:

$413 + x = $373
x = $373 - $413
x = - $40

So, the transaction is a withdrawal (or loss) of $40.
